from sslModel.base import sslBase
import public
import hmac
import hashlib
import json
import time
import requests
from typing import Dict, Any, Optional, Tuple
class main(sslBase):
def __init__(self):
super().__init__()
def __init_data(self, data):
self.account_id = data["AccountID"]
self.access_key = data["AccessKey"]
self.secret_key = data["SecretKey"]
self.base_url = "https://dmp.bt.cn"
def _generate_signature(self, method: str, path: str, body: str) -> Tuple[str, str]:
"""生成 API 签名"""
timestamp = str(int(time.time()))
signing_string = f"{self.account_id}\n{timestamp}\n{method.upper()}\n{path}\n{body}"
signature = hmac.new(
self.secret_key.encode('utf-8'),
signing_string.encode('utf-8'),
hashlib.sha256
).hexdigest()
return timestamp, signature
def _request(self, method: str, path: str, data: Optional[Dict[str, Any]] = None) -> Dict[str, Any]:
"""发起 API 请求"""
url = self.base_url + path
body_str = ""
body_bytes = None
if data is not None:
body_str = json.dumps(data, separators=(',', ':'))
body_bytes = body_str.encode('utf-8')
timestamp, signature = self._generate_signature(method, path, body_str)
headers = {
"Content-Type": "application/json",
"X-Account-ID": self.account_id,
"X-Access-Key": self.access_key,
"X-Timestamp": timestamp,
"X-Signature": signature
}
response = requests.request(
method=method.upper(),
url=url,
data=body_bytes,
headers=headers
)
result = response.json()
if not result.get("status"):
raise Exception(f"API 请求失败: {result.get('msg')}")
return result
